Latest Patents

One of his latest patents is titled "Method and apparatus of echo planar imaging with real-time determination of phase correction coefficients." This invention provides an apparatus and method of phase correction whereby changes in phase characteristics are measured during data acquisition. Accordingly, phase correction parameters that are applied during image reconstruction are updated in real-time. This adaptive and dynamic phase correction reduces variability in image fidelity during the course of long MR scans, such as EPI scans, and provides consistent artifact reduction during the course of an MR scan.
